So I got my test results and at 4w5days my hcg was 2488 and was classified as high. What can cause this? Were any of of you other ladies this high? And if so what was the outcome?
 
I didn’t get my levels tested so not speaking from experience, but I’ve read posts from a few ladies who have naturally higher HCG levels. Multiples could also cause it, but there isn’t really a way to be sure.
 
That is kinda high. Once your levels hit 1500 and above they can see something on an ultrasound so you should get one done bc maybe you're further along?
 
My dates are for sure spot on that's why I'm worried. I have an ultrasound scheduled on the 21st. And I should get second numbers monday.
 
I had my bloods done yesterday at exactly 5 weeks and mine are 6640.
 
Your numbers look good - I wouldnt worry about them being high as you can see mine are really high. The numbers can vary per person and Id take high over low anyday. As long as they are doubling every 24-48 hours then thats all thats important. :)
 
Numbers vary from pregnancy to pregnancy. It's not the number that's important. It's the doubling time x
